Bush picks conservative for Supreme Court
Washington U.S. President George W. Bush, stung by the rejection of his first choice, nominated conservative judge Samuel Alito on Monday to replace moderate Justice Sandra Day O'Connor in a bid to reshape the Supreme Court and mollify his political base.
“Judge Alito is one of the most accomplished and respected judges in America,” the President said in announcing Judge Alito's selection.
